> > I had to do two things to get covers for videos in mythweb->mythvideo:
> > 
> > in /var/www/mythweb, create a symlink to 
> > /home/mythtv/.mythtv/MythVideo called video_img_path, then in 
> > /var/www/mythweb/config/conf.php, set the
> > line: define('video_img_path', 'video_img_path');
> > 
> > I'm guessing the define value is what the symlink needs to be called.
